Water Meters / Totalizers
Each system with a timer on it will have 2 water meter inputs. Each of these can have the incoming contact
defined, allowing the controller to keep track of water usage. If desired, the controller can calculate evaporation
loss by subtracting the deference between a system's two water meter inputs.
2.9.a. Option W Totalizers
MegaTron MT controllers with "W" option may have 1 to 4 auxiliary flowmeter inputs. These additional inputs
are for tracking various flow meter devices (additional water meters or flowmeters in a metering pump's
discharge tubing). They can also be linked to a system's water meter input for additional tracking and alarm
capabilities, including bleed flow/no flow, exceeding too much flow in a 12- or 24-hour period. Units with
Auxiliary Flow meter inputs have a Home menu selection for Totalizers. The Totalizer menu has selections
for each of the System Water Meters, plus one named Aux Meters.

CONTACT VALUE - Defines the numerical value for a
contact; i.e. 10.
CONTACT UNIT - Defines the units of measurement
for a contact; i.e. Gallons / Contact. If there is a mA
input set for a gpm or lpm reading, that mA input can
be selected in the Contact Units as the source for the
meter input to total flow rate.
RESET TOTAL - Resets the totalizer count.
EVAP CALC - Defines which way to subtract the two
water meter inputs for an evaporation value.
DEBOUNCE - An additional amount of time the input
will wait before accepting another water meter contact
to reduce false contacts from a chattering read switch.
Select the system water meter to set up or go to Aux
Meters to set-up the auxiliary flow meters.
